Mark Pierce,  Associate Director of Knowledge and Research at the Community Foundation

At the Community Foundation we like to think we have a fairly close relationship with our grantees, and that they wouldn’t be too shy to tell us where we could be doing better. And a bit of constructive criticism is genuinely appreciated. But we also know it can be difficult, particularly if you are a new grantee or have been unsuccessful in applying, to raise concerns about how a funding partner conducts their business.
